Side-by-Side Comparison
| Criteria | Sendible | SocialBee |
|---|---|---|
| Rating | ★★★★ 3.8(16) | ★★★★ 3.8(43) |
| Pricing Model | paid | paid |
| Starter Price | $29/mo | $29/mo |
| Free Tier | No | No |
| Platforms | Web, iOS, Android | Web |
| Learning Curve | moderate | easy |
| API Available | Yes | Yes |
| Best For | Social media agencies managing multiple clients who need white-label capabilities | Small businesses and solopreneurs who want organized, category-based content scheduling |
| Verdict | situational | recommended |

Sendible
Pros
- ✓Best white-label features
- ✓Client approval workflows
- ✓Automated optimal timing
- ✓Reasonable agency pricing
Cons
- ✕Less useful for non-agencies
- ✕UI less modern than competitors
- ✕Analytics could be deeper
SocialBee
Pros
- ✓Unique category-based organization
- ✓Good AI content generation
- ✓Evergreen recycling
- ✓Affordable pricing
Cons
- ✕Limited analytics
- ✕No social listening
- ✕Smaller platform than competitors
